Local resource exposure via deceptive RDP files
Published Apr 14, 2026 · Updated Apr 14, 2026
Spoofing in Windows Remote Desktop on affected Windows 10, Windows 11, and Windows Server builds allows remote attackers to expose local resources. Remote Desktop Connection opened attacker-supplied RDP files without clearly identifying the destination or separately confirming requested resource redirections. A user must open the file and proceed; redirected drives, clipboard data, credentials, cameras, and other devices can then be exposed to the attacker-controlled host.
